Cornillon-Confoux is a small town, also known as a commune, located in the south of France. It is part of the region called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ur. This charming place is found in the department of Bouches-du-Rhône. In 2008, about 1,345 people lived there.

How Many People Live Here?

The number of people living in Cornillon-Confoux has changed a lot over the years. This table shows how the population has grown or shrunk since 1793.

Historical population
Year Pop. ±%
1793 566 —    
1800 514 −9.2%
1806 534 +3.9%
1821 620 +16.1%
1831 614 −1.0%
1836 648 +5.5%
1841 621 −4.2%
1846 673 +8.4%
1851 631 −6.2%
1856 617 −2.2%
1861 598 −3.1%
1866 612 +2.3%
1872 565 −7.7%
1876 495 −12.4%
1881 455 −8.1%
1886 408 −10.3%
1891 354 −13.2%
1896 377 +6.5%
1901 364 −3.4%
1906 338 −7.1%
1911 324 −4.1%
1921 273 −15.7%
1926 292 +7.0%
1931 328 +12.3%
1936 338 +3.0%
1946 326 −3.6%
1954 388 +19.0%
1962 411 +5.9%
1968 562 +36.7%
1975 810 +44.1%
1982 980 +21.0%
1990 1,060 +8.2%
1999 1,167 +10.1%
2008 1,345 +15.3%

Art and History in Cornillon-Confoux

This town has some interesting cultural features, including art and old buildings.

Famous Sculpture

Near the local church, you can find a special sculpture called The Victory of Ikaria. A famous artist named Igor Mitoraj, who lived in the area, created it. This sculpture was put in place at the end of 2007. It stands close to a statue of the Virgin Mary, which represents purity. It is also near a symbol of the French Republic called Marianne.

Traditional Stone Shelters

All around the village and in the nearby areas, you can see many traditional French bories. These are old stone shelters built without any mortar. They show a unique part of the region's history and building style.
